It was only until 1975 that Congress refused a last-minute request from president Gerald Ford for $300 million in aid for South Vietnam, the American ally in the conflict there. The request was made just weeks before the fall of Saigon to the North Vietnamese army on April 30, 1975. There is a long debate among US historians, intellectuals and politicians about whether Congress is to blame for "losing" Vietnam. As with other controversial issues, there is no unanimous conclusion.

<h3>How many exceptions are there to the Miranda rule?</h3>
- When interrogation is necessary for the protection of the public, a police officer is not required to read the Miranda warnings.while requesting information on a booking.This article examines a recent ruling by the US Supreme Court on Miranda warnings and describes the six acceptable exceptions to the Miranda rule.
- Nevertheless, there are two exceptions to the mandated Miranda warnings for a suspect who is in custody.The first is referred to as the "rescue doctrine" exemption, while the second is referred to as the "public safety" exception.
- In New York v. Quarles, the Court acknowledged the need for a Miranda exception where authorities must neutralize an urgent threat to public safety and ruled that this supersedes the Fifth Amendment guarantee against self-incrimination.
